Set across a multi-level venue, the restaurant provides several distinct areas for private and semi-private dining. For smaller groups, the Chef’s Table seats up to eight guests and offers a direct view of the open kitchen, creating a more immersive experience. The Snug accommodates up to 24 guests and features wood-panelled walls, greenery and a tucked-away setting that still captures the energy of the main space.
For mid-sized groups, the Panel Room can host up to 30 guests in a light, neutral setting, while the Private Dining Room offers a more eclectic space, complete with a mezzanine level, exposed brick walls, soft furnishings and its own 1950s-style kitchen bar. Larger and more informal events can be hosted in the Deli, a quirky private room with direct street access, or in MIXO, which can accommodate up to 80 guests and is well suited to larger group dining or cocktail-making experiences.
Food can be tailored to suit the occasion, with options ranging from breakfast meetings with pastries and avocado on toast to buffet-style menus, grazing boards and set dinners. Dishes may include arancini, burrata and sea bass, alongside mains such as fish and chips, chicken Milanese or cheeseburgers, with desserts including sticky toffee pudding, chocolate brownie or summer berry crumble. Drinks include a curated wine list, cocktails and sharing serves, with mixology classes available for groups.
